A fantastic opportunity has arisen to become part of the unique, innovative, warm and welcoming Knowsley MBC Hospital and Home Tuition Service. We are seeking an enthusiastic and inspirational teacher who would like to broaden their experience by working with vulnerable young people experiencing physical and/or mental illness in Knowsley. You will work under the direction of the Hospital and Home Tuition Service Manager to be an integral part of an outstanding education team and will show evidence of a career providing high quality education for students with a wide range of needs, both academically and socially, and including SEND, to support the continuing development of the Knowsley HHT Service. You will work across several areas; The Children's Ward at Whiston Hospital, at our learning base at the George Howard Centre in Whiston, and in student homes throughout Knowsley. You will work alongside the support staff within the service, delivering support to children and their families. You will also work in partnership with schools and multidisciplinary teams and be willing to work flexibly in a challenging yet rewarding environment. Our students have the opportunity to make progress through personalised learning programmes delivered in small groups or in one-to-one tuition. Staff and students build positive nurturing relationships, which enable students to grow in confidence, self-acceptance and compassion for themselves and others.
